封装--Java基础037
2017-01-14 20:42
225 查看
/* 面向对象三大特征: 1. 封装 2. 继承 3 多态。 根本原因: 由于其他人可以直接操作sex属性。可以对sex属性进行了直接的赋值。 封装: 权限修饰符:权限修饰符就是控制变量可见范围的。 public : 公共的。 public修饰的成员变量或者方法任何人都可以直接访问。 private : 私有的, private修饰的成员变量或者方法只能在本类中进行直接访问。 封装的步骤: 1. 使用private修饰需要被封装的属性。 2. 提供一个公共的方法设置或者获取该私有的成员属性。 命名规范: set属性名(); get属性名(); 疑问: 封装一定要提供get或者set方法吗? 不一定, 根据需求而定的。 规范 : 在现实开发中一般实体类的所有成员属性(成员变量)都要封装起来。 实体类:实体类就是用于描述一类 事物的就称作为实体类。 工具类(Arrays数组的工具类): 封装的好处: 1. 提高数据的安全性。 2. 操作简单。 3. 隐藏了实现。 */
相关文章推荐
- JAVA基础第五天学习日记_面向对象开发思想、匿名对象、封装、私有、构造函数
- 黑马程序员-----java基础四(之封装特性)
- 【java基础】--(2)面向对象特征之概念、封装、继承
- Java基础笔记 – 面向对象三个特征 继承、封装、多态及编程细节提示
- java基础三大特性——封装、继承与多态
- java基础回顾---封装继承多态
- 黑马程序员_java基础之封装
- java基础三大特性——封装、继承与多态
- 黑马程序员Java基础-面向对象编程-封装生成数组工具类
- Java基础05:面向对象;类与对象;匿名对象;成员变量;局部变量;封装;构造函数
- java基础三-------面向对象--封装
- java基础(四)——面向对象_类、封装、构造器、this
- 黑马程序员---java基础之面向对象(一)三大特征(封装,继承,多态)
- JAVA基础:将数据库操作封装
- 黑马程序员JAVA基础-封装
- 黑马程序员_Java基础_面向对象(概述、类与对象关系、成员变量、封装private、构造函数和构造代码块、this关键字)
- 黑马程序员 Java基础<一>---> 面向对象与类之概述(匿名对象、封装、构造函数、this、静态等)
- 黑马程序员 05 Java基础教学 - 05 - 面向对象(1) 之 类、对象、封装
- Java基础04 封装与接口
- 黑马程序员--java基础--封装